Gyros
Greek Pita Sandwich
GYROS

1/2 lb Ground lamb
1/2 lb Ground beef
2 slices semi dried (day old) bread
2 Cloves garlic, chopped fine
2 Tbls Fresh parsley, chopped
1 tsp Salt
1/4 tsp Pepper
1/4 tsp Ground funugreek
1/4 tsp Ground cumin
1 Egg, beaten

TZATZIKI SAUCE
(Yogurt cucumber sauce)

2 Small Cucumbers, Peeled, Seeded & Diced
1 1/4 cup Yogurt
2 Tbls Olive oil
Juice of 1 lemon
4 Garlic cloves, minced
1 Tbls Fresh dill, chopped
White pepper
Salt

 

TZATZIKI SAUCE
1) Combine yogurt, olive oil, lemon juice, garlic and pepper in a bowl. Cover and refrigerate for one hour.

2) Blend yogurt mixture with a whip until smooth.

3) Dry cucumbers by patting with paper towels.

4) Add Cucumbers and dill to yogurt mixture.

5) Salt and pepper to taste.

GYROS
1) Mix lamb and beef in a glass bowl.

2) Crumb bread into meat mixture.

3) Add Spices and mix well.

4) Stir egg into meat mixture.

5) Form mixture into 2 large patties and place on a medium hot grill for 5 minutes per side or until the Gyros is cooked through.

Serve sliced gyros on warm pita bread with fresh sliced tomatoes, onions and Tzatziki sauce (Yogurt cucumber sauce)
